- 博客(2)
- 资源 (4)
- 收藏
- 关注
原创 html元素是否包含另外一个元素,以及classList属性
如何判断一个元素A包含了元素B呢?如果不用contains方法的话,如何做呢? 腾讯面试的时候也出了这道题啊,当时没看dom的知识,所以一抹黑哦。。。 那就判断B是否为A的child喽,那也就是A是B的parent或者parent.parent或者parentNode.parentNode.parentNode.... 所以就这样向上遍历一下B的父亲节点,看A是不是在这个父节点链上。代码如下: fu
2016-08-29 18:43:07 1510
原创 重构以前的代码
仔细分析了一下重构这个事,很多程序员都是写了一些不负责任的代码,给项目积累了很多“疾病”后一走了之。这样是对自己的解放,也是对自己的不负责。因为代码重构,的确能让你更加的了解自己,提升自己。 最近重构了一段以前的代码。也受到了一些别人的启发。代码就不全部拿来了,就记录一下重构的几个重要的思路。 1.策略模式: 如果你的代码里有这样一个结构: if(v==a){ }else if(v
2016-08-23 19:04:07 293
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人